Helo command rejected: need fully-qualified hostname

Document ID: 2580HQ

ISSUE:

Delivery failed error message from remote server: Helo command rejected: need fully-qualified hostname.

SOLUTION:

If you receive the above message, follow the steps below to resolve the issue:

  1. Get the properties for My Computer, next click the tab; Network Identification.

  2. Click the properties button

  3. Under Computer name specify the HOST / Computer (example; mail)

  4. Next click the More button

  5. Where it says, "Primary DNS suffix of this computer; enter your primary domain name.

  6. Click OK and OK again

Now full computer name is: mail.domain.com

** You may have to restart the system**
